The full breakdown
What it's made of and why it matters
Titleist Perma Soft uses genuine leather (likely goat or sheepskin) as the primary material, which is inherently low-toxicity and breathable. The synthetic backing, typically polyester or nylon, provides structure and durability. The critical unknown is the water-repellent coating (water-repellent coating) finish applied to the leather surface; most golf gloves use fluorocarbon-based treatments (potentially PFAS-containing) or wax-based alternatives, but Titleist has not publicly disclosed which chemistry they employ.
The brand's record and disclosure
Titleist (owned by Acushnet) does not publish detailed material safety or PFAS disclosure statements for apparel products. No major recalls or safety controversies specific to Perma Soft gloves have been documented in public records. The brand's silence on water-repellent coating treatment chemistry is typical of the golf industry but leaves consumers without confirmation of PFAS avoidance or use.
How it compares in its category
Golf gloves typically use leather combined with synthetic backing and water-resistant treatments. Perma Soft is mid-to-premium tier; competitors like Callaway and FootJoy face identical transparency gaps on water-repellent coating chemistry. Wool-blend or untreated leather gloves exist as lower-chemical alternatives but sacrifice water resistance and durability that golfers often prioritize.
If you buy it
Wash gloves by hand in cool water with mild soap; avoid hot water or machine washing, which can degrade both leather and backing integrity. Store in a ventilated area to prevent mold growth in the leather. Replace when the grip surface becomes slippery or leather shows cracks; worn coatings cannot be safely re-applied at home. If PFAS content is a priority, contact Titleist directly to request water-repellent coating specification or consider untreated leather alternatives.
Beyond PFAS: other things we checked
Established hazard classes for this product type, assessed from public information. These never change the PFAS grade; a Likely flag caps the Verdict at “Buy with care.”
water-repellent coating (water-repellent coating) treatment chemistry
Golf gloves commonly receive fluorocarbon-based water-repellent coating finishes that may contain PFAS. Titleist has not disclosed whether Perma Soft uses fluorocarbon, fluorine-free, or wax-based water-repellent coating; this is the primary unresolved hazard for this product.
Leather tanning residues
No specific contamination reports for Titleist Perma Soft. Modern tanneries in developed regions typically use chrome or vegetable tanning with regulated heavy metal limits, though full supply-chain transparency is rare in golf products.
Synthetic backing (polyester/nylon) degradation
Synthetic backings can shed microfibers with repeated handling and washing, particularly if the material is thin or damaged. This is a minor exposure for a glove (not a textured garment) but relevant with frequent use and washing.
Adhesives and lamination compounds
Leather-to-synthetic bonding may use polyurethane or rubber-based adhesives; no hazardous off-gassing reports exist for Titleist gloves, and the small surface area limits exposure risk compared to larger apparel or footwear.
Mold and bacterial growth if stored wet
Leather naturally wicks moisture and can harbor mold if not dried promptly after use in humid climates. This is a maintenance issue rather than a manufacturing hazard but is relevant to safe ownership.
